Types of Metal Roofing

Aluminum Roofing

Aluminum roofing offers long-term durability with resistance to rain and saltwater. The material provides better protection than galvanized steel, along with smaller spangles for a more cohesive look. If you’re interested in all-around surface protection, aluminum roofing should be on your shortlist.

Steel Roofing

Steel comes in multiple forms, including galvanized, galvalume, and weathering steel. Each has an alloy coating that delivers various degrees of protection against the weather and impacts. Steel roofing has come a long way in the past half-century, with highly flexible designs and pricing for commercial and residential structures. 

Copper Roofing

Copper has been a staple of metal roofing for millennia with a lifespan that extends well-over two centuries. It serves as the gold standard of roofing with its noise-dampening composition and unique visual appearance. Copper costs up to $22 per square foot, making it the most expensive metal roofing material.

Zinc Roofing

Zinc costs slightly more than other metal roofing in Northern Virginia and Maryland, but the benefits are worthwhile. It’s 100% recyclable, universal, easily manipulated, and highly durable. Zinc also has a lower melting point than its steel and copper counterparts, allowing manufacturers to create shingles with a quarter of the energy. 

Tin Roofing

Many people view tin roofing as synonymous with steel or metal roofing. Tin was a popular option in the 19th century but has faded from relevancy in recent years. It offers many of the same benefits as other metal roofs with a naturally corrosion-resistant exterior.

Corrugated Metal Roofing

Corrugated metal roofing in Northern Virginia and Maryland bolsters homes, cabins, sheds, and other structures without breaking the bank. It’s energy-efficient, easily installed, and provides long-term durability. Treat your corrugated metal roof well, and you can expect it to last anywhere from 25 to 60 years.

Advantages of Metal Roofs

Durability

The average metal roof lasts 40 to 70 years. The conventional asphalt roof, which covers most homes in Northern Virginia and Maryland, only lasts 12 to 20. That means asphalt roofs require replacement two or three times more frequently than metal, which drives up homeownership and roof installation costs. 

Eco-Friendly

Millions of tons asphalt shingles end up in landfills each year. Metal shingles are recyclable, so sorting facilities can reuse the material instead of adding to the waste. Some metal shingles use 100% recycled materials, including steel, which doesn’t lose strength upon reuse.

Energy Efficient

You can slash your energy bills up to 40% with the addition of a metal roof. The reflective surface minimizes heat absorption, which keeps you and your family comfortable indoors. It can also retain cold air better than conventional roofing materials, so you don’t have to crank your HVAC system.

Minimal Maintenance

Once you install metal shingles, you can all but forget about them. The weather-resistant exterior does most of the work for you when staving off dirt, grime, and leaves. The design means you also don’t have to worry about blistering, curling, cracks, or holes.

How long does metal roofing last?

The longevity of metal roofing in Fairfax County depends on the material. Most metal roofs last between 40 and 70 years. Some materials, like copper, when put in an ideal environment with proper maintenance, can last you more than 200 years.

Do metal roofs make noise when it rains?

One of the myths lingering over metal roofs is that they’re louder than conventional ones when it rains. Metal roofs aren’t any noisier than your average roof. The shingles contain a sheathing between the metal and your home, which dampens the noise from rain, hail, wind, and other impacts.

Do metal roofs lower your energy bills?

Metal roofs lower your energy bills in two ways. First, they reflect more sunlight than asphalt shingles, and second, they retain more indoor air because of superior insulation. The two benefits lead to less strain on your HVAC system to maintain a more stable temperature. The regulatory properties mean the addition of a metal roof can lower energy bills up to 40%.
